Document: Based on a classical model of infection epidemics, we developed a mathematical model particularly adapted to the requirements and specificities of the CoV-outbreak (SECIR-model, Figure 1 ). Figure 1 : The scheme of the SECIR model, which distinguishes susceptible (S), healthy individuals without immune memory of CoV, exposed (E), who already carry the virus but are not yet infectious to others, carriers (C), who carry the virus and are infectious to others but do not yet show symptoms, infected (I), who carry the virus with symptoms and are infectious to others, hospitalized (H), who experience a severe development of the disease, transferred to intensive care unit (U), dead (D), and recovered (R), who acquired immune memory and cannot be infected again.
